I’ve been using WSJT-X for a very long time, since it was called JT65-HF and one thing I’ve always found a little tricky was making fine adjustments to the Pwr control slider. I often want to make small adjustments and I’ve found that clicking on the slider itself can cause much larger adjustments than required. If you don’t click exactly on the centre, the slider jumps.
I just found out that it’s possible to adjust the slider using a mouse wheel, or a gesture using a trackpad which does the same as a mouse wheel. This may be old news to a lot of people but if you don’t already know it, it’s an absolute game changer. I can now just hover the mouse somewhere near the slider and move it up and down smoothly, without it jumping all over the place.
